In April and May, the weather is beautiful, the Yellowfin are biting, and Captain Mike and his crew are ready to have you aboard for an unforgettable Gulf Stream Fishing experience. Fishing the waters of the Outer Banks can be VERY fruitful, but there is more than one reason to go with an experienced captain who has fished these waters firsthand for over 3 decades like Captain Mike! In April, Yellowfin Tuna is going to be yourr main catch. Yellowfin tunas put up a great fight and are typically in big schools so multiple hookups are a common occurrence; It is not unusual to hook one on every line. As May comes along, target species largely depends on the water temperatures. If the temperatures stay cool the Yellowfin tuna will hang around longer but when the temperature begins to rise the Marlins and Dolphin begin to appear. As water temperatures begin to rise they get a great run of gaffer dolphins. Gaffer dolphins are larger dolphins that get their name because you need a gaff to get them in the boat. When the gaffer dolphin first show up it is not unusual for us to catch a limit of these big dolphins which is a whole lot of meat for the freezer! During both months, there is also the chance to catch wahoo and Blue Marlin aboard these extended day adventures with Captain Mike. Redfish are among the most popular inshore saltwater fish in the U.S., and for good reason—they're common, give a great fight, and provide a challenge for every level of angler. These fish inhabit a range of water types, so you'll fish a it all, from inshore shallows to deeper nearshore areas with plenty of underwater structure. Expect to practice a variety of techniques, from jigging and bottomfishing to sightcasting, depending on what the fish are doing that day. What types of fishing charters are common in Hatteras?

Deep Sea fishing is the most popular in Hatteras as well as inshore fishing, nearshore fishing, and flats fishing.

The most commonly sought after species in Hatteras are: 1. redfish, 2. speckled trout, 3. flounder, and 4. cobia.

The most common fishing techniques in Hatteras are light tackle fishing, live bait fishing, and sight casting but artificial lure fishing and trolling are popular as well.
